| The scooter, Vespa was born in the spring of 1946 as a combined result of Enrico Piaggio's intuition and Corradino D'Ascanio's design ingenuity. Pontedera factory produced the first fifteen Vespa units, delineating the true meaning of elegance, comfort, and style in transportation leading to the production of a whopping 35,000 units by the end of 1949. |
